The Top 5 Healthy Foods That Are Rich In Antioxidants

The Top 5 Healthy Foods That Are Rich In Antioxidants

Antioxidants are something you always hear about. People say you need them, but you may be unsure of what they actually do inside the body. The body naturally produces some antioxidants to inhibit oxidation. You don’t want living organisms to rust, essentially, to the point of no return. This is why it is integral to eat foods that are rich in antioxidants.

The body also produces free radicals. Usually, we tell people to eat foods that fight free radicals, but not all free radicals are bad. The liver produces free radicals, which help to detoxify the body. Certain oxygen molecules, when they travel freely in the body, can cause oxidative damage, ultimately resulting in free radical formation. This is where antioxidants come into play. They help combat the formation of these free radicals.

The Standard American Diet (SAD) is full of processed foods, meats, dairy products, medications, and fast foods, and we are constantly exposed to pollutants. All of these contribute to oxidative stress, which is why you need these 5 antioxidant-rich foods in your life.

#1: Blackberries

When it comes to dark-colored berries, almost all of them are rich in antioxidants. Blackberries are at the top of the list, beating out strawberries, cranberries, and raspberries. If you eat 1 cup of blackberries, you’ll fulfill half of your daily vitamin C requirement. Did we mention that vitamin C is an amazing antioxidant? Well, it is!

#2: Kale

Kale is all over the health world, and for good reason. Kale is rich in cancer-fighting antioxidants and beta-carotene, which is a powerful antioxidant that promotes healthy skin. Additionally, kale is a great source of vitamin K, which is great for your bones.

#3: Pecans

As if you needed another reason to love pecans. Pecans are loaded with antioxidants, but make sure you buy raw pecans. Don’t buy the flavored or roasted pecans because the way they are treated counteracts the antioxidant benefits.

#4: Broccoli

Broccoli is very easy to incorporate into your diet because it is incredibly versatile. Roast it, eat it raw, throw it in a stir-fry, or make it into a soup. It has incredible cancer-fighting antioxidants, which have been known to decrease a person’s risk of developing different bladder cancers.

#5: Lemons

You can put fresh lemon juice in just about anything, but the easiest way to reap its benefits is by squeezing it into your water. Lemons are high in vitamin C, which helps fight free radicals and nourish cells in the body. Other citrus fruits like oranges and grapefruit are also great sources of vitamin C.
